Emmanuel Thomé wrote:
> On Mon, Nov 08, 2004 at 01:53:25PM -0800, Nate Lawson wrote:
>>Why the switch to real mode to run the BIOS call? Can't this be done
>>from vm86 mode?
>
> Yes it can, at least I think so. You're welcome to tweak this to do it in
> a vm86 mode if you like.
I mostly work on FreeBSD and since it has clean vm86 support routines,
it doesn't involve any inline assembly to do the lcall there. I assume
Linux has something similar. I think re-entering real mode and
overloading the resume asm code to run just one instruction is a bit of
a hack.
